Alexander College Tuition Fee

ProgramHeader LabelTuitionTerm Duration
Undergraduate tuition fee$285.00 per credit14 weeks
English as a Second Language (ESL)ENGL 068, 078, 088$3,000.00 per level14 weeks
English for Academic Purposes (EAP)ENGL 098$2,295.0014 weeks
ENGL 099$1,530.00
Academic Upgrading (excluding ESL/EAP)e.g., MATH 0993 credit undergraduate tuition fee
University Preparation ProgramUPRE 099$1,710.00

Alexander College Admission Requirements

Admission Requirements:

  • All programs require evidence of English language proficiency. Learn about the 12 different ways to satisfy the English proficiency requirement.
  • Completion of Secondary Education (12 years, or equivalent) or mature student status, or post-secondary transfer
  • Academic and/or GPA requirements specific to individual programs
  • Demonstrated proficiency in the English language
  • Canadian Citizenship or legal authorization to study in Canada
  • Aged at least 16+ years of age

International and Domestic Students

Students who are Canadian citizens, permanent residents, or Convention refugees are classified as domestic students. Students who are dependents of diplomats or have their own diplomat status may also be classified as domestic students after presenting the necessary documentation. All other students are classified as international students.

Minor Student Admission

Applicants who are 18 years of age or under, and who have not graduated from high school, may be admitted in the category of Minor Student. Minor students are eligible to enrol in non-credit coursework only. Applicants under 16 years of age are not admissible.
